Как изменить учетные данные локального репозитория Github .git / config, чтобы обойти 403?

#git #github #visual-studio-code #vscode-settings #credentials

#git #github #visual-studio-code #учетные данные

Вопрос:

Я пытаюсь подключиться к своему удаленному репозиторию Github со своего рабочего компьютера, на котором настроены другие учетные данные, и вот что я получаю:

 remote: Permission to *** denied to ***.
fatal: unable to access 'https://github.com/***': The requested URL returned error: 403
  

Я пытался изменить .gitconfig , но это не помогло.

Я подозреваю, что VS code каким-то образом запоминает рабочие учетные данные, но я не могу найти, где это.

Ответ №1:

Нашел ответ здесь. В конце концов, речь шла не о сбросе учетных данных VS code.

Найдите .git/config файл в каталоге вашего репозитория и в разделе [remote "origin"] измените URL с

https://my-username@github.com/my-username/my-repo.git

Для

ssh://git@github.com/my-username/my-repo.git .

После этого я смог без проблем запустить восходящий поток. Я не совсем понимаю, почему, но это работает.